Default Re: Moist-N-Aire temperature gauge question

Thanks guys, I had it at 50 and was good at 64,65 & 67 (3 hygrometers top, middle and bottom) I turned it up to 60 and it was at 71, 74 & 77!!! so I put it back down to 50, will check tonight when I get off work.

I just wasn't sure if there was a scale out there that I needed to go by, I am thinking 50-55 is the ticket.
